Designed for those undertaking research for the first time, this fully updated edition of The Researcher’s Toolkit is a practical and accessible guide for all those partaking in small-scale research. Jargon-free and assuming no prior knowledge, it covers the entire research process, from defining a research topic or question through to its completion.

David Wilkinson is based in Nexus at the University of Leeds where he runs his consultancy – Research Toolkit. He edited the first edition of this textbook and has been a researcher and evaluator for over twenty years.
Dennis Dokter is the Manager of Data & Insights and Smart Cities lead at Nexus, the University of Leeds’ innovation hub and community. He possesses wide-ranging experience in writing research proposals as well as coordinating, managing, and leading them.
